我有这些代码:
function ambil_coa(hal_aktif,scrolltop){
if($('table#coa-list').length > 0){
// alert('ada tablenya');
$.ajax('http://'+host+path+'/ambil',{
dataType:'json',
type: 'POST',
success: function(data){
$('table#coa-list tbody tr').remove();
$.each(data.record , function(index, element){
$('table#coa-list').find('tbody').append(
'<tr align="center">'+
' <td class="text-nowrap">'+element.no_urut+'</td>'+
' <td class="text-nowrap">'+element.customer_ID+'</td>'+
'</tr>'
)
});
}
});
}
}
我想在下面添加一些条件语句。
如果element.customer_ID
返回0
,echo "-"
;
else
如果值不是0 echo "Customer Name"
如何将条件脚本写入append
部分?
答案 0 :(得分:2)
最简单的方法是使用三元运算符:
$('table#coa-list').find('tbody').append(
'<tr align="center">'+
' <td class="text-nowrap">'+element.no_urut+'</td>'+
' <td class="text-nowrap">'+(element.customer_ID == 0? '-' : element.customer_Name )+'</td>'+
'</tr>'
)
如果你想使用另一个元素属性,那么:
fscanf()